Output 52a80809717fae1c0cabf997c01364021ae8a913c90f0c5eee722723989dc914:0

value
1073861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 066fd63f9d8f068f3d9fe81866b7ca43597a92f5 OP_EQUALVERIFY OP_CHECKSIG
address
1b32iWFQGK5AhYxdCaHK1dLs9FfiyukDU
transaction
52a80809717fae1c0cabf997c01364021ae8a913c90f0c5eee722723989dc914
spent
true